I have sendmail installed on my linode with the only purpose to use it for sending emails from PHP (i.e. wordpress comments to moderate).

But I cant receive anything :(

I have edited
Code:
/etc/mail/local-host-names
and put all my domains here.

And edited
Code:
/etc/mail/relay-domains
to put the same domains.

And finally edited
Code:
/etc/mail/access
and added a line with my linode ip address to allow RELAY.

But none of this makes the thing working :(

I also tried to look for a iptables issue, but even after doing an
Code:
iptables -F
to leave the firewall blank... I cant get this working.

Please, I need some help :roll:

PS. I'm using Debian lenny.

I just found the solution in a more deep search in the forum :)

This was my problem: http://www.linode.com/forums/viewtopic. ... l+iptables

After changed hostname to a FQDN and running
Code:
sendmailconfig
now I can send emails from PHP :D
